Uploaded image for project: 'OpenShift Storage'
  1. OpenShift Storage
  2. STOR-2453

Triagebot maintenance

XMLWordPrintable

    • Icon: Epic Epic
    • Resolution: Unresolved
    • Icon: Minor Minor
    • None
    • None
    • Triagebot maintenance
    • Quality / Stability / Reliability
    • 0% To Do, 0% In Progress, 100% Done
    • False
    • Hide

      None

      Show
      None
    • False
    • Not Selected
    • None
    • None
    • None

      CoreOS team stopped using and maintaining Triagebot and we need to find a way to maintain it, unless we want to stop using it too and use plain Jira for stuff like timeouts on needinfo.

      Currently we don't know how many people are using the bot, but even if we move the repo the existing images should stay and will just stop being updated.  If there are others using it we could let someone else maintain the repo and move it under "openshift" org in GitHub. We could also move it to GitLab.

      The maintenance burden should not be too high due to the repo being mostly inactive, there is no vendoring and versions are not pinned to any version in requirements.txt.

      Currently the bot is deployed in MP+ from personal Quay instance which is not optimal, for details see our wiki page [1]

      We should also consider image builds as we need them stored somewhere so the deployment on MP+ can access them. Currently the images are stored on Quay [2].

      For communicating with CoreOS team we can use their Slack channel '#forum-rhel-coreos' and tag '@coreos-leads' if needed since there is no assigned maintainer at this point.

      Things that should be done:
      1) try asking around (aos-devel mailing list?) and try to find some other volunteer or team willing to maintain the repo of possible
      2) plan how to build and store images
      3) migrate the repository

      [1] https://gitlab.cee.redhat.com/devel/ocp-storage-devel/-/wikis/Triagebot-guide
      [2] https://quay.io/repository/coreos/triagebot?tab=tags&tag=latest

              Unassigned Unassigned
              rbednar@redhat.com Roman Bednar
              None
              None
              None
              None
              Votes:
              0 Vote for this issue
              Watchers:
              3 Start watching this issue

                Created:
                Updated:

                  Estimated:
                  Original Estimate - 3 weeks
                  3w
                  Remaining:
                  Remaining Estimate - 3 weeks
                  3w
                  Logged:
                  Time Spent - Not Specified
                  Not Specified